Abstract


The purpose of this study was to discuss the ethical role of the guidance and counseling profession, especially the principle of confidentiality in the implementation of online counseling. This research method uses a descriptive qualitative literature review that examines several scientific articles accompanied by the results of interviews and previous research results. The data analysis technique uses descriptive analysis techniques. The results of this study explain that counselors have an ethical responsibility to explain the meaning of confidentiality in group counseling. The principle of confidentiality is important considering that the professional ethics of the counselor pays more attention to the privacy of the counselee, because it will involve comfort and security in receiving counseling services. In the implementation of online counseling, counselors can anticipate the possibility of unwanted violations by making efforts such as: (1) Conducting interviews and evaluations when forming groups, (2) Conducting in-depth observations when providing classical services in the classroom, (3) Grouping individuals who voluntarily and voluntarily participate in group activities, (4) Giving informed consent containing personal data, applicable rules, and cooperation agreements which contain the privacy security of themselves and other members, (5) Members affix their signatures on the under a statement about what they will accept if they do not fulfill it.
